Ticket SEC-4410: Vault locked — Burrowscan credentials unavailable. The secrets vault holding tokens for Burrowscan, our typo-squatting package scanner, locked itself after a failed rotation overnight. Scans of the internal registry are currently suspended, leaving new package publishes unscreened. On-call: initiate the vault recovery procedure promptly and confirm scanner heartbeat afterward. The recovery flow will ask for the team passphrase, which is listed below.

strongbox words: wenion-olimir-quenion-tamius

Handing off the Quillboard report builder sort bug. Short version: the column sorter isn't stable, so rows with equal keys shuffle between exports and clients notice. Fix is to swap in the stable comparator from the grid library — half done on my branch. Tests for tie-breaking are stubbed. Context, repro steps, and my notes are on the internal page.

operations page: https://jenkins.zemvarcloud.local/job/merge_requests/repo/build/73930b4b30f0a8ed

This page summarizes provenance findings from the Copperline stale-cache bug. The release shipped with artifacts rebuilt from a cache keyed on an outdated source digest, so two modules lagged one commit behind the tagged revision. Contributing factors: the cache invalidation job at the Harrowfen mirror ran after, not before, the artifact freeze. Going forward, the release manager must confirm that the provenance report shows matching digests for every module before sign-off. The affected release carried the token below.

pipeline stamp: htk31_f769b577b3028a4e9958e5bb8d1259a

**Ticket: Deep links open wrong tab after app update**

Product: Marlowe Commuter app. After the latest update, deep links from trip-reminder pushes land on the home tab instead of the trip detail screen. Affects both platforms; web links are fine. Support: advise customers to open the trip manually from Recent Trips as a workaround — no data is lost. Engineering suspects the new route table shipped without the legacy alias map. When attaching customer reports, include the diagnostic trace token shown below.

pipeline stamp: htk9_ce63042d9